Dukes Creek Falls Trail

Trail to the beautiful Dukes Creek Falls


Description:

The trail is wide and easily walked for the first .9 mile, with an easy descent on a narrower path for the last bit.

The hiking path leads to an observation deck excellent for viewing the 250-foot-high waterfall.


State: Georgia
County: White
Length: 1.1 miles
Difficulty: 3
